Madeleine-Rose TREMBLAY was born 28 January 1730 in Baie-Saint-Paul, Canada, New France
Madeleine-Rose TREMBLAY was the child of Louis TREMBLAY and Marie-Madeleine BONNEAU and the grandchild of: (paternal) Pierre TREMBLAY and Marie-Madeleine ROUSSIN (maternal) Joseph BONNEAU dit LABÉCASSE and Madeleine DUCHESNESpou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):
Madeleine-Rose married Louis SIMARD 23 November 1744 in Les Éboulements, Canada, New France . The couple had (at least) 2 children.
Louis SIMARD was born 14 September 1721 in Baie-Saint-Paul, Québec, Canada (Saint-Pierre-et-Saint-Paul-de-Baie-Saint-Paul). Louis died 22 April 1800 in Baie-Saint-Paul, Québec, Canada (Saint-Pierre-et-Saint-Paul-de-Baie-Saint-Paul). Louis was the child of Étienne SIMARD dit LOMBRETTE and Rosalie BOUCHARD.
Madeleine-Rose TREMBLAY died 17 March 1770 in Contrecœur, Province of Québec, Canada .

From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
